Creation of New Prediction Units in Data Mining System on NetBeans Platform
Havlíček, David ; Bartík, Vladimír (referee) ; Lukáš, Roman (advisor)
The issue of this master's thesis is a creation of new prediction unit for existing system of knowledge discovery in database. The first part of project deal with general problems of knowledge discovery in database and predictive analysis. The second part of the project deal with system developed on FIT, for which is module implemented, used technologies, concept and implementation of mining module for this system. The solution is implemented in Java language and is a built on the NetBeans platform.

Data Mining Module of a Data Mining System on NetBeans Platform
Výtvar, Jaromír ; Křivka, Zbyněk (referee) ; Zendulka, Jaroslav (advisor)
The aim of this work is to get basic overview about the process of obtaining knowledge from databases - datamining and to analyze the datamining system developed at FIT BUT on the NetBeans platform in order to create a new mining module. We decided to implement a module for mining outliers and to extend existing regression module with multiple linear regression using generalized linear models. Mining Modules of Data Mining System on NetBeans Platform
Henkl, Tomáš ; Lukáš, Roman (referee) ; Zendulka, Jaroslav (advisor)
The master's thesis deals with the knowledge discover in databases and with the extending of the data mining systems in the Oracle environment developed at the VUT FIT. The system kernel conception incorporates an interface that enables the adding of data mining modules. The objective of the thesis is to learn this interface and implement and embed the data mining module for decision-tree classification into the application. In addition, the thesis compares the application with similar commercial product SAS Enterprise Miner
Functionality Extension of Data Mining System on NetBeans Platform
Šebek, Michal ; Zendulka, Jaroslav (referee) ; Lukáš, Roman (advisor)
Databases increase by new data continually. A process called Knowledge Discovery in Databases has been defined for analyzing these data and new complex systems has been developed for its support. Developing of one of this systems is described in this thesis. Main goal is to analyse the actual state of implementation of this system which is based on the Java NetBeans Platform and the Oracle database system and to extend it by data preprocessing algorithms and the source data analysis. Implementation of data preprocessing components and changes in kernel of this system are described in detail in this thesis.

Graphical Layer for a Data Mining System
Gálet, Michal ; Burget, Radek (referee) ; Zendulka, Jaroslav (advisor)
The issue of this MSc. project is a design and implementation of a graphical user interface for a data mining system. The application is a front-end for an existing data mining library and allows the user to visually define the data mining process using a graphical editor and a component palette. The solution is built on a NetBeans Rich Client Platform and takes many benefits from using rich components available in this platform. The user may define his work in the projects, edit and persist DMSL documents, run the mining tasks and view the mining results.  The system is designed to emphasize the modularity and extensibility of the solution.
Cluster Analysis Module of a Data Mining System
Riedl, Pavel ; Burgetová, Ivana (referee) ; Zendulka, Jaroslav (advisor)
This master's thesis deals with development of a module for a data mining system, which is being developed on FIT. The first part describes the general knowledge discovery process and cluster analysis including cluster validation; it also describes Oracle Data Mining including algorithms, which it uses for clustering. At the end it deals with the system and the technologies it uses, such as NetBeans Platform and DMSL. The second part describes design of a clustering module and a module used to compare its results. It also deals with visualization of cluster analysis results and shows the achievements.
